性能测试设计比工具更重要? - 解析测试重点
性能测试设计比工具更重要? - 解析测试重点
在性能测试领域,很多人过于关注工具的使用,而忽略了测试设计本身。事实上,测试设计才是性能测试成功的基石,而工具只是实现目标的手段。
为什么测试设计如此重要?
- 明确测试目标: 测试设计的第一步是明确测试目标,例如确定系统需要承受的最大用户数、响应时间等。没有明确的目标,性能测试就失去了方向。* 设计合理的测试场景: 性能测试需要模拟真实的业务场景,例如用户登录、浏览商品、下单等。测试场景的设计需要基于实际业务需求,才能保证测试结果的有效性。* 选择合适的指标: 性能测试需要关注多个指标,例如响应时间、吞吐量、资源利用率等。不同的测试目标需要关注不同的指标,而选择合适的指标是保证测试结果可分析的关键。* 准备测试数据和环境: 性能测试需要准备大量的测试数据,并且需要在接近真实的环境中进行测试。数据和环境的准备是否充分,直接影响测试结果的准确性。
工具只是手段,设计才是灵魂
市面上有很多性能测试工具,例如LoadRunner、JMeter等。这些工具可以帮助我们模拟大量的用户请求,并收集各种性能指标。然而,工具本身并不能保证测试的成功。
如果测试设计不合理,即使使用了最先进的工具,也无法得到准确、可靠的测试结果。相反,如果测试设计合理,即使使用简单的工具,也能获得有价值的测试结果。
总结
在性能测试过程中,测试设计的重要性远远大于工具的使用。充分的测试设计是保证测试结果准确性、可重复性和可比较性的关键。因此,我们应该将更多的精力放在测试设计上,而不是仅仅关注工具的使用。
原文地址: http://www.cveoy.top/t/topic/Oxp 著作权归作者所有。请勿转载和采集!